std::chrono::tzdb_list::erase_after
来自 cppreference.cn
const_iterator erase_after( const_iterator p ); |
(C++20 起) | |
擦除迭代器 p 之后所引用的 std::chrono::tzdb。该迭代器必须可解引用。否则,行为未定义。除了指向被擦除元素的指针、引用或迭代器之外,其他任何指针、引用或迭代器都不会失效。
[编辑] 参数
p | - | 要在其后擦除的位置的迭代器 |
[编辑] 返回值
指向被擦除元素之后元素的迭代器,如果没有此类元素,则为 end()
。
[编辑] 注意
tzdb_list
旨在实现为单向链表,其接口类似于 std::forward_list。然而,它没有 before_begin()
,因此无法擦除第一个元素。